Windows 10 gives you a fast way to find your mouse pointer by circling it when you hit the CTRL key. Here’s how to set it up. In the search box on your task bar, search for Mouse, and select it from the list. Once you're in Mouse settings, select Additional mouse options from the links on the right side of the page.

WebIn Windows 11, Windows 10 & Windows 8.1, right-click the Start menu and select Device Manager. In Windows 8, swipe up from the bottom, or right-click anywhere on the desktop and choose "All Apps" -> swipe or scroll right and choose "Control Panel" (under Windows System section) -> Hardware and Sound -> Device Manager.
